About

The Direction Control Versions of the PIRAMID XL offer a field adjustable switch to control the direction of a target based on the direction of movement. A three-position digital switch allows the sensor to be set to detect 1) only approaching targets, (2) only receding targets or (3) both approaching and receding targets. There are three different version of the Direction Control PIRAMID XL. Each version varies in its detection capabilities with a focus on either vehicles or pedestrians/intruders.
